Rivula niveipuncta is a
species of moth of the
family Noctuidae. It is
found in Asia,
including India and Taiwan.

Rivula basalis is a moth of the
family Erebidae first described by
George Hampson in 1891. It is
found in
South India, Sri Lanka, Indo-China, Thailand...
